"Measurement of resistance by bridge method. Methodical instructions for laboratory work No. 2" is a unique manual created by a team of authors, which will become an indispensable assistant for students, graduate students and teachers in the field of physics and electrical engineering. This book is not just a set of methodological guidelines, but a whole world in which readers are immersed, seeking to understand the intricacies and nuances of measuring electrical resistances. The book focuses on the bridge method, which is one of the most accurate ways to measure resistance. This method, based on the principles of electrical circuits and measurement theory, allows to achieve high accuracy and reliability of the results. The authors explain in detail how to properly configure the bridge, what parameters to take into account and how to interpret the data obtained. Each instruction in the book is accompanied by clear illustrations and examples, which makes the learning process more accessible and understandable. The book will be especially interesting for students of technical specialties who study electrical engineering, physics and related disciplines. It can also attract the attention of teachers who are looking for high-quality teaching materials for laboratory work. Due to the clear structure and logical presentation of the material, the manual will be useful to both beginners and those who already have experience in conducting similar experiments. The topics raised in the book cover a wide range of issues related to measurements in electrical circuits. The authors emphasize the importance of accuracy and accuracy in scientific research, which is a key aspect in any scientific work. The book also addresses issues related to systematic and random errors, which allows readers to better understand how to avoid common mistakes when conducting experiments.
